Projects

EvenTora
EvenTora is a robust, full-featured event management web application developed by Team #4b.
Designed to streamline how people host, discover, and participate in events, EvenTora supports a wide range of scenarios β from free community meetups to private, paid workshops.
Built with a strong focus on security, scalability, and user experience, the platform is protected by JWT-based authentication and offers advanced features for both hosts and participants.
π Key Features
β Secure Authentication & Role-based Access
JWT-based authentication for session management
Role-based access control with User, Host, and Admin levels
Middleware-protected routes to prevent unauthorized access
π Event Creation & Hosting
Hosts can create public or private events
Events may be free or have a fee-based entry
Custom fields for date, time, location, and detailed descriptions
Cover image upload support using Cloudinary
π§ββοΈπ§ββοΈ Participant Management
Manual approval flow for private or paid event join requests
Hosts can ban, unban, or invite specific users
Track total participants and monitor their payment status
π³ Payment Integration
Integrated with a secure payment gateway for processing fees
Tracks successful transactions for hosts and admins
Auto-generates revenue reports and monthly earnings
π Event Discovery & Exploration
Explore upcoming and featured events from the homepage
Filter events by type (Public/Private), pricing (Free/Paid), and category
Search functionality for quick event lookup
π Admin Dashboard & Moderation
Dedicated admin panel to monitor users, events, and payments
Admins can approve or reject events to ensure platform quality
Visual insights with:
β’ Summary cards
β’ Revenue trend charts
β’ User growth statistics
Manage reported users and moderate flagged content

Cyclify β Bicycle E-Commerce Platform
Cyclify is a modern, full-featured bicycle e-commerce application that offers a seamless shopping experience for cycling enthusiasts.
Developed with a focus on performance, usability, and security, Cyclify provides both customers and admins with robust tools to manage product listings, orders, and payments effortlessly.
The platform is built using React.js, Redux, Ant Design, and TypeScript on the frontend, with a powerful backend powered by Node.js, Express, and MongoDB.
π΄ββοΈ Key Features
β Secure Authentication & Role-based Access
User authentication with login and registration
Role-based access with separate Admin and Customer dashboards
Protected routes to prevent unauthorized access
ποΈ Product Browsing & Shopping
Customers can explore a wide range of bicycles with detailed product descriptions
Dynamic search, filtering, and category-based browsing
Add to cart and update quantities directly from the product page
π³ Payment Integration
Integrated with ShurjoPay for secure online payments
Transaction tracking for both customers and admins
Order confirmation after successful payment
π¦ Order Management & Tracking
Users can view their order history and track delivery status
Admins can update order statuses (e.g., Pending, Shipped, Delivered)
Detailed view of each order with product breakdown and payment info
π οΈ Admin Dashboard
Admins can manage all products β add, edit, or delete bicycles
Order overview with detailed insights and customer info
Inventory management with real-time updates

Portfolio - Website
Portfolio Website is a personal web application designed to showcase my skills, projects, and professional experience in a clean, modern, and responsive layout.
The website highlights my full stack development expertise through detailed project presentations, tech stack descriptions, and interactive elements to engage visitors and potential employers.
Built with a strong emphasis on usability, performance, and professional design, the portfolio demonstrates my commitment to quality and attention to detail.
π― Key Features
π» Project Showcase
Detailed presentation of completed projects with descriptions, tech stack, and live/demo links
Projects are categorized and ordered to highlight my best work first
Interactive UI elements to enhance user experience
π Professional Experience & Skills
Clear, concise display of my educational background, certifications, and work experience
Showcasing skills with proficiency levels and relevant tools
π Contact & Social Links
Easy-to-use contact form for direct communication
Links to professional social profiles like LinkedIn, GitHub, and Twitter
β‘ Performance & Responsiveness
Optimized for fast loading and smooth navigation
Fully responsive design adapting to desktops, tablets, and mobile devices

MixHub - Blog Platform
Mixhub is a dynamic and user-friendly blog platform designed to deliver diverse content across multiple categories such as fashion, food, travel, parenting, and more.
Developed to enhance content discovery and engagement, Mixhub offers rich browsing features, social sharing options, and wishlist functionality, creating a seamless reading experience for users.
The application focuses on performance and interactivity, built with React.js, React Router, and Tailwind CSS, with real-time data support via Firebase.
π° Key Features
π Blog Discovery & Filtering
Users can browse blogs by category including fashion, travel, recipes, and more
Built-in search functionality for quick blog lookup
Category filter for focused content exploration
π Featured & Recent Sections
Homepage highlights top-ranked featured blogs
Recent section displays the latest blog posts for returning users
Each blog shows the authorβs name and profile image for added credibility
π Wishlist Functionality
Users can add blogs to a personal wishlist for later reading
Wishlist section lets users view and manage saved blogs
Improves user retention and reading continuity
π€ Social Sharing
Integrated sharing to platforms like Facebook, Instagram, and Twitter
Boosts blog visibility and engagement beyond the platform
Encourages content virality and broader reach
π± Responsive Design
Optimized for mobile, tablet, and desktop viewing
Clean and professional UI powered by Tailwind CSS
Fast load times and smooth navigation on all devices

TechRadar
Tech Radar is a modern, easy-to-use gadget discovery platform that helps users explore the latest phones, tablets, laptops, and more β all in one place.
Built to simplify tech decision-making, Tech Radar aggregates product data, real-time pricing, and launch updates in a clean, searchable interface. Users can compare features, check current promotions, and save favorite items for later.
The project is powered by React.js, React Router, and Tailwind CSS on the frontend, with backend services handled by Express.js, MongoDB, and Firebase for authentication and deployment.
π± Key Features
π Product Discovery & Comparison
Explore a wide range of tech gadgets by category β phones, tablets, accessories, and more
Advanced filtering and search to help users narrow down choices
Product pages with detailed specs, images, and pricing
π Real-Time Updates
Automatically shows new product launches as theyβre added
Reflects live price drops and seasonal promotions
Helps users track market trends and timing for best deals
πΎ Wishlist & Favorites
Users can save favorite items to a personal wishlist
Accessible wishlist menu to revisit saved products anytime
Improves decision-making and return visits
π Responsive & Accessible UI
Clean, responsive layout optimized for all screen sizes
Accessible navigation and user-friendly interactions
Professional UI styled with Tailwind CSS
π Authentication & Deployment
User authentication using Firebase for a secure experience
Deployed on Vercel for fast, global performance
Version-controlled with Git and GitHub for maintainability

Online Bookstore UI
Online Book Store UI is a clean, intuitive user interface designed to provide a seamless browsing and shopping experience for book lovers.
The application features modern UI elements with an emphasis on readability, navigation, and user engagement. Itβs crafted using React.js and Tailwind CSS to ensure responsiveness, performance, and aesthetic appeal.
This frontend-only project showcases key e-commerce design practices including category browsing, book detail views, and add-to-cart interaction β laying the foundation for a full-stack book store experience.
π Key UI Features
π Explore Books by Category
Books organized into categories like Fiction, Non-fiction, Business, and Self-Help
Users can browse collections or search for specific titles
Clickable categories and filters for a refined experience
π Book Details View
Detailed book pages with title, author, rating, price, and description
Cover image display for quick visual reference
Clear call-to-action buttons for buying or adding to cart
π Add to Cart Flow
Functional add-to-cart button on each book card and detail page
Cart component UI designed to show item list, quantity, and total price
Responsive layout that adapts across devices
π¨ Clean, Professional UI
Minimalist yet modern interface using Tailwind CSS
Interactive components built with React.js
Consistent design language and color palette for a polished feel